>> > > cmpxchg_emu_u8() emulates one-byte cmpxchg() in terms of four-byte
>> > > cmpxchg() for the architectures lacking native one-byte atomics.
>> > > The same architectures also lack native two-byte cmpxchg(), where
>> > > such an operation is not supported and either fails to compile via
>> > > BUILD_BUG() or fails to link, because the bad pointer sentinels
>> > > these architectures declare are never defined.
>> > >
>> > > Add cmpxchg_emu_u16(), the two-byte sibling. It reads the enclosing
>> > > word with READ_ONCE(), splices the two target bytes through a union
>> > > and loops on cmpxchg() of the full word until the compare succeeds.
>> > > Like cmpxchg_emu_u8() it is fully ordered.
>> > >
>> > > The Kconfig symbol gating this file is renamed from
>> > > ARCH_NEED_CMPXCHG_1_EMU to ARCH_NEED_CMPXCHG_1_2_EMU, as it now
>> > > selects both the one-byte and the two-byte emulation.

>> > Why uintptr_t? Shouldn't it just be u16?
>> > (Which probably means the code would better if it was just 'unsigned
>int')
>>
>> I suspect that Bradley is just following my cmpxchg_emu_u8() example,
>> which also returns uintptr_t.
>>
>> I remember that *something* broke when I made this be u8, but I cannot
>> recall what the problem was.
>>
>> Bradley, could you please try making it be u16 as David suggests just to
>> see what happens? Who knows? Maybe it was a compiler issue that has
>> since been fixed. Or maybe the macros and asms using cmpxchg_emu_u8()
>> need that uintptr_t for some reason.
>
>I think the uintptr (unsigned long) cast is needed to stop a compile
>error when exchanging pointers.
>But that is an issue with the #define not the called functions.
>
>Possibly changing the #define to have:
> unsigned long ul_old = (unsigned long)(old);
>Or even, with the type check from:
> unsigned long ul_old = (unsigned long)(0 ? *(ptr) : (old));
>(with the same for 'new')
>and the removing all the casts where the value are used might be better.
